    Sales Managers Plan, direct, or coordinate the actual distribution or movement of a product or service to the customer. Coordinate sales distribution by establishing sales territories, quotas, and goals and establish training programs for sales representatives. Analyze sales statistics gathered by staff to determine sales potential and inventory requirements and monitor the preferences of customers.

    This program equips successful students with the foundational skills to pursue a career in industrial sales, which differs significantly from retail sales. The successful industrial sales person must identify and understand the needs of potential industrial customers, determine if their product will add value by improving effectiveness, efficiency, and quality, then appropriately communicate with the customer to develop long-term partnerships.
